The Chimney Is Supposed To Win

A properly working fireplace or stove relies on draft, the upward pull that should carry combustion gases out through the flue. When that draft is healthy, smoke leaves the way it is meant to. When it falters, smoke spills into the room, and that spillage is the single most important thing to notice. A cold flue at startup, a partly blocked chimney, a house held under negative pressure by other fans, or simply lighting a fire the wrong way can all cause the flue to lose its pull. If you see smoke rolling back over the lip of the firebox, or smell it drifting into the room during a fire, the correct response is not to reach for a scented candle. It is to stop, ventilate if it is safe to do so, and find out why the smoke is not going up the chimney. A hearth that repeatedly pushes smoke inward is telling you something about the building’s pressure or the flue’s condition, and that is a maintenance question, not a cleaning one.

Alarms Are Not Air Monitors

A carbon monoxide alarm is not optional decor in a home with any combustion appliance, and it is also not the same thing as an air quality monitor. Carbon monoxide is colorless and odorless, so no amount of watching the air or trusting your nose substitutes for a working alarm placed according to its instructions. Just as importantly, the glowing number on a consumer air monitor or a purifier’s display does not measure carbon monoxide and must never be treated as a safety device. The guide to carbon monoxide, radon, and monitor boundaries explains why those displays sit in a different category from life-safety alarms. If an alarm sounds, if anyone feels unwell around the appliance, or if a fuel-burner seems to be backdrafting, the clean-air project is over for the moment: follow emergency guidance and get outside to fresh air.

Ash Is A Source, Not Just A Mess

Cold ash looks inert, but it is a reservoir of extremely fine particles that become airborne at the slightest disturbance. Scooping it in a hurry, using a leaky bucket, reaching for an ordinary vacuum that blows the finest dust straight through its bag, or leaving the ash pan open where a door draft can reach it will loft soot across the whole room. Treat ash handling as slow, contained work: wait until the fire is fully out and the ash is genuinely cold, move it into a covered metal container kept for that purpose, and clean the hearth with methods meant for fine soot rather than a quick sweep that just stirs it up. This is where a hearth connects to the wider logic of source control before air purifiers : the source is not only the flames but the residue, the tools, and the cleaning method around them. And the residue should never be masked. Scented sprays, candles, and incense meant to signal a clean room simply add their own particles and compounds on top of the soot that is still there.

Firewood Brings The Outdoors In

A stack of firewood carries bark, grit, insects, moisture, and outdoor odor, and where you keep it changes the room. A small amount by the hearth is convenient, but a large indoor pile becomes a standing dust and moisture reservoir, especially if it is stored against a return grille, a supply vent, a cold exterior wall, or upholstered furniture. Wood that smells musty, feels damp, or sheds debris every time it is moved is working against your air rather than with it. Fuel condition also feeds back into smoke: wet or poorly seasoned wood tends to smolder and smoke more, and a smoky fire leaves residue that lingers long after the flames die down. The specifics vary by appliance and fuel, so follow the relevant instructions rather than folklore, but the indoor-air principle holds steady: make less smoke, send combustion byproducts out the intended path, and keep the fuel from becoming room dust.

Filtration And Carbon Play A Narrow Part

A portable air cleaner sized for the room can help mop up the fine particles that escape during ordinary hearth activity, and placing it where room air can actually reach it makes a real difference after a bit of ash dust or a puff of startup smoke. What it cannot do is grant permission. A purifier is not a reason to run a smoky appliance, burn painted or treated scraps, ignore an alarm, or skip a chimney sweep. Odor is a separate matter again. Activated carbon can reduce some smoke smell when there is genuinely enough media and enough contact time, but as the guide to activated carbon for odors and gases makes clear, fireplace odors tempt people into buying far more deodorizing product than a thin carbon layer can deliver. Carbon may soften leftovers; it does not fix a draft fault, dry out wet wood, or excuse careless ash handling.

The House Fights For The Same Air

A hearth does not operate in isolation from the rest of the home’s ventilation. A kitchen range hood, a bathroom exhaust fan, a clothes dryer, or a central HVAC blower all move air, and in a fairly tight house a strong exhaust running while a fire is getting started can pull the pressure down enough to reverse a weak flue and draw smoke back inside. Because this crosses into safety, resist tidy universal rules and instead watch your own house: note which fans are running when smoke misbehaves, and bring in a qualified person when the pattern is anything other than ordinary. The same record-keeping discipline used for outdoor smoke helps here. Even though the smoke-day plan builder is framed around wildfire days, the habit it encourages, closing off avoidable sources, running appropriate filtration, adding no new particles, and logging what changed, maps neatly onto a hearth session: jot down the weather, which fans were on, how the fire started, any smoke smell, the ash cleanup, and the alarm status.

Keep The Hearth From Becoming The Room

A good boundary is partly physical and partly habit. Keep the screen or glass doors in the position the appliance calls for, store tools and the covered ash container so their dust stays near the hearth rather than beside the sofa or a return grille, clean soot with methods suited to it, and keep indoor wood storage modest. Replace vague complaints of a smoky smell with a short, specific note: when the smell appeared, which fan was running, what was burning, whether the damper and vent path were set correctly, and what changed afterward. That small record turns a recurring nuisance into a solvable pattern.

The boundary is also a stopping rule, and this guide is practical education rather than medical advice or a guarantee that any room is safe. If smoke keeps entering the living space, if an alarm activates, if the chimney or appliance condition is unknown, if there has been fire damage, or if anyone feels ill around its use, this is no longer a simple clean-air routine. Handle the safety issue first, with the right professional and the right alarm or test, and let a cleaner room follow from combustion going where it belongs.
